DIGICEL (TONGA) SHARES THEIR THOUGHTS FOR FATHERS DAY.

Thursday 19th May, 2011: Digicel (Tonga) celebrates Father’s Day with thousands of Fans of their ‘Digicel Tonga’ Facebook page. Prizes including free Credit, Digicel Mobile Handsets, t-shirts, caps and cash are offered daily on the fan page, with special competitions a regular highlight.

One of the lucky winners, Lisiate Schaaf won a Mooli T313 mobile phone after entering the ‘Best Father Comment Competition’ on the Digicel Tonga fan page.  Mr Schaaf one the competition after gaining the most ‘likes’ on his comment. Facebook offers members the opportunity to show support for status updates, comments, photos, etc. by ‘liking’ them, with a simple click of a mouse.

The BEST FATHER COMMENT took the popular facebook fan page by storm, offering the opportunity for Digicel Tonga Fans to show their love and support for all the fathers of Tonga. Being able to share their comments in the popular public forum only added to the excitement and interest in the competition. Fans of the page had the opportunity to view other’s comments and cast their votes by ‘liking’ them

The winner, with the most ‘likes’, received a free Mooli T313 mobile phone, collected at Digicel (Tonga) main office situated at Hala Fatafehi. The competition commenced on Wednesday 11th of May and closed on Saturday 14th of May, 2011 at 12 midnight.

Digicel (Tonga) continues to bring innovative and popular promotions and competitions to the kingdom through its Digicel Tonga fan page on facebook with daily giveaways and prizes.

 

 

About Digicel

After nine years of operation, Digicel Group Limited has 11 million customers across its 32 markets in the Caribbean, Central America and the Pacific. The company is renowned for delivering best value, best service and best network.

 

Digicel is the lead sponsor of Caribbean, Central American and Pacific sports teams, including the Special Olympics teams throughout these regions. Digicel sponsors the West Indies cricket team and is also the title sponsor of the Digicel Caribbean. In the Pacific, Digicel is the proud sponsor of several national rugby teams and also sponsors the Vanuatu cricket team.

 

Digicel also runs a host of community-based initiatives across its markets and has set up Digicel Foundations in Jamaica, Haiti and Papua New Guinea which focus on educational, cultural and social development programmes.

 

In 2004, Digicel developed Digicel Rising Stars – an annual talent show to support aspiring young music artists in the Caribbean. The show has spanned the Eastern Caribbean, Haiti, Jamaica and Trinidad & Tobago ranking as one of the top-rated shows.

 

Digicel is incorporated in Bermuda and its markets comprise: Anguilla, Antigua & Barbuda, Aruba, Barbados, Bermuda, Bonaire, the British Virgin Islands, the Cayman Islands, Curacao, Dominica, El Salvador, Fiji, French Guiana, Grenada, Guadeloupe, Guyana, Haiti, Honduras, Jamaica, Martinique, Nauru, Panama, Papua New Guinea, Samoa, St Kitts & Nevis, St. Lucia, St. Vincent & the Grenadines, Suriname, Tonga, Trinidad & Tobago, Turks & Caicos and Vanuatu. Digicel also has coverage in St. Martin and St. Barts in the Caribbean.
